Located in Callander, Dalgair House Hotel is in a rural area and in a national park. Galleria Luti and Hamilton Toy Collection are cultural highlights, and some of the area's landmarks include Rob Roy's Grave and Dunblane Cathedral. Blair Drummond Safari Park and Scottish Real Ale Shop are also worth visiting.

Excellent and friendly people.Made my stay very easy.Central and impressive old building.great value for a night’s stay and included a very nice breakfast with excellent service.Friendly,homely and typical generous Scottish hospitality.
Traditional B and B with a few antiques scattered around. Has a lovely wee pub downstairs well used by locals which has pool and a Duke box with libbuc at the weekends. The room was clean, had a decent mattress, warm bedding, bath and shower, decent size towel provided and a reasonable size flat screen TV on the wall. Plenty of storage and hangers. Now for the best stuff. The food, available in the bar or bistro next door at very reasonable prices it is fresh and plentiful and breakfast was also excellent and served in the chic but cosy wee bistro attached to the B and B. Staff were all efficient and welcoming with a warm easy manner. We will be back and the surrounding village of Callander with the Trossach hills rising around it is stunning. We came away feeling just as one should after a wee break. Rested and positive.
Unfortunately our stay in Dalgair House 11th November was a disappointment. It was the start of our holiday in Scotland and we had a long journey on the following day to the north of the country. We did not get a wink of sleep until after 1.00 am as there was a thundering and loud disco/live music/juke box immediately under our bedroom. The heating was switched off during the night although the temperature was -2 degrees on Sunday morning. We would have appreciated been told about the loud music. We thought that Dalgair House was a small hotel but it seems it is a tavern with rooms upstairs. Very unpleasant stay.
